Concrete pouring device for building
The invention discloses a building concrete pouring device which comprises a supporting frame and three arc-shaped plates, a circular through groove is formed in the upper surface of the supporting frame, a vertical pipe is arranged in the circular through groove, the vertical pipe is in spherical hinge joint with the inner wall of the circular through groove, a sliding rod is slidably connected into the vertical pipe, a circular block is arranged at one end of the sliding rod, and the arc-shaped plates are arranged in the circular through groove. The circular block is in spherical hinge joint with the sliding rod, arc-shaped grooves are formed in the two sides of the three arc-shaped plates, connecting assemblies are arranged in the arc-shaped grooves, the three arc-shaped plates are connected with one another to form a circle, each connecting assembly comprises a steel plate, and the two ends of each steel plate are located in the arc-shaped grooves and are in sliding connection with the arc-shaped grooves; first springs are fixedly connected between the two ends of the steel plate and the side walls of the arc-shaped grooves. The circular block is arranged at one end of the sliding rod, when the circular block collides with the arc-shaped plate, the arc-shaped plate collides with the steel bar frame, concrete is oscillated, and then gaps and hollowing between the concrete are reduced.
